Income of the Separate Trust Sample Clauses

Income of the Separate Trust. A proportion of the net taxable income (if any) of each Separate Trust created for each Series may be included in the assessable income of the relevant Investors on 30 June each year. Whether or not a Separate Trust will have net taxable income in a year of income will be dependent on whether the Hedge Security Deed is enforced by the Security Trustee. Each Investor’s proportion of the net taxable income (if any) of the relevant Separate Trust will be determined by the number of Units held by the Investor in a particular Series. Should the Hedge Security Deed be enforced by the Trustee it is recommended that Investors should seek independent taxation advice.
